Mozilla Thunderbird javascript: URL launches default handler
| thunderbird-javascript-handler-launch (19173) |
Description:
Thunderbird versions prior to 0.9 running on Microsoft Windows uses the system's default handler to load javascript: URLs, which could expose Thunderbird to other browser's vulnerabilities.

Remedy:
For Thunderbird:
Upgrade to the latest version (1.0 or later), available from the Mozilla Web site. See References.

- CVE-2005-0148: Thunderbird before 0.9, when running on Windows systems, uses the default handler when processing javascript: links, which invokes Internet Explorer and may expose the Thunderbird user to vulnerabilities in the version of Internet Explorer that is installed on the user's system. NOTE: since the invocation between multiple products is a common practice, and the vulnerabilities inherent in multi-product interactions are not easily enumerable, this issue might be REJECTED in the future.
